Joshua 2:1

Joshua son of Nun sent two spies out from Shittim secretly and instructed them: "Find out what you can about the land, especially Jericho." They stopped at the house of a prostitute named Rahab and spent the night there.

Hebrews 11:31

By faith Rahab the prostitute escaped the destruction of the disobedient, because she welcomed the spies in peace.

James 2:25

And similarly, was not Rahab the prostitute also justified by works when she welcomed the messengers and sent them out by another way?

Numbers 25:1

When Israel lived in Shittim, the people began to commit sexual immorality with the daughters of Moab.

Matthew 1:5

Salmon the father of Boaz (by Rahab), Boaz the father of Obed (by Ruth), Obed the father of Jesse,
